Exploring the Thornton Castle

After that splendid breakfast, we took a stroll around the castle as well as the manicured lawn and landscaped grounds.

2017-07-18 21.41.16.jpg

The castle dates back to the 14th century and is chock full of original, antique features but has now been extensively improved to cater for a more modern lifestyle. You can see the contemporary extension and garage they built at the back from the picture below!

2017-07-18 07.46.33.jpg

The sheer breadth of scenic beauty around the castle really took my breath away! I had no idea of the scale of 1400 acres until I actually saw it with my own two eyes. It was astonishing!

The lawn and gardens were all beautifully maintained too. I was so impressed when told by Griselda that such a big castle was only managed by the Thornton family and two additional contract workers! I expected a large team consisting of at least a dozen people or so! :)

Stonehaven Harbour

After that oh-so-memorable walk throughout Thornton castle and it's lush surroundings, we all hopped in our car and headed up to the popular nearby coastal town of Stonehaven.

Stonehaven in located to the south of Aberdeen. About half an hour's drive from Thornton Castle where we stayed. It is renowned for its peaceful harbour and famous for its Hogmanay fireballs ceremony.

I found this quaint little town quite appealing. The semi-enclosed harbour was very serene with beached sailing yachts parked up on the shore.

2017-07-22 16.48.41.jpg

2017-07-22 16.48.31.jpg

2017-07-22 16.41.32.jpg

From the information board, we learned some history about the harbour itself. During the 18th century, we learned it was the main port used for imports and exports of different goods. The main exports consisted of grain as well as potatoes, whisky and cured fish. Coal and lime formed the main import merchandise at the time.

Fishing also played an important role in Stonehaven Harbour for many years passed. The most common catches are predominantly clams (scallops). There also used to be a fish market in Stonehaven, which has now since closed down.

The harbour today is used mainly for recreational purposes. In summer time, The Stonehaven Yacht Club holds many events such as water-based racing and other such sporting activities. From time to time, some yachts even visit these shores from European countries, adding to the already colourful scene.
